What is Jiggle-gagging?


1.

v. When a party conversation reaches a lull, and instead of a simple pause in dialogue, dance moves are seen usually to background music.

The combination of a lull/lolly-gagging and doing a jig.

As the conversation about Frank's girlfriend slowly dissipated a few of the girls began jiggle-gagging to the Cut Copy track pumping in the other room.

"Wow, that was some great Jiggle-Gagging Simone, way to keep the party alive!"
